    LEGO The Legend of Zelda Great Deku Tree Set Revealed

    Releasing on September 1 for $299.99.

    LEGO has revealed a new set based on The Legend of Zelda, themed after the franchise’s Great Deku Tree. The set will release on September 1, 2024, and will be available for $299.99.

    Over the last few years, LEGO has collaborated with Nintendo to release various sets based on their properties. They’ve released sets based on Animal Crossing, Mario, as well as sets based on the Nintendo Entertainment System. They’ve also collaborated with other video game properties like Minecraft, Overwatch, Horizon, as well as other beloved franchises and consoles.

    LEGO Legend of Zelda Set Revealed, Based on the Great Deku Tree

    LEGO has officially confirmed that they will be making a set based on The Legend of Zelda franchise. The set is based on the popular character/location from the series, the Great Deku Tree. The set is a 2-in-1; buyers can change between the Deku Tree from Ocarina of Time, or the one from Breath of the Wild/Tears of the Kingdom. The set costs $299.99 and will be available on September 1, 2024.

    The set features several figures from The Legend of Zelda franchise. It includes Young Link and Adult Link from Ocarina of Time, as well as Link and Zelda from Breath of the Wild/Tears of the Kingdom. Further, it also includes several Koroks from both Breath of the Wild and Tears of the Kingdom. The set also includes the infamous enemy type from Ocarina of Time, the Skulltulas. It also includes 2500 pieces.
